Marietta Math Tutoring FAQ
It's normal for students to struggle with math. Math can be complex and challenging, and it requires students to think in abstract ways. While it's not rare for students to have a hard time understanding the concepts and principles they learn in their math classes, it is important they get the help they need to try to overcome their learning obstacles. Math may be challenging, but it is necessary. It never goes away, so it's crucial that students develop a good understanding of the subject early on. Fortunately, there is assistance readily available to help students do that. If your child is falling behind in their math class, and you want to help them develop the skills they need to be successful, consider partnering them with a personal math tutor. A math tutor will break down the material and present it in a way that is easier for your child to comprehend.
